Jazz great Cyrus Chestnut and new music luminaries International Contemporary Ensemble (ICE) join Yamaha family

Cyrus Chestnut has been described by the New York Times as "a highly intelligent improviser with one of the surest senses of swing in jazz" and by the New York Daily News as "the rightful heir to Bud Powell, Art Tatum and Errol Garner."  A graduate of the Berklee College of Music, Mr. Chestnut has performed with jazz greats such as Betty Carter, Dizzy Gillespie, James Carter, Joe Lovano, Roy Hargrove, Donald Harrison, Freddie Hubbard and Yamaha Artists Chick Corea and Tim Warfield, among others.  His versatility and consummate musicianship have also allowed him to explore collaborations in classical music, including performances with the Chicago Symphony Orchestra, the Boston Pops, and next season at major performing arts venues with the Turtle Island String Quartet and with the opera great Kathleen Battle, with whom he has frequently performed.

International Contemporary Ensemble (ICE), described by the New York Times as "one of the most accomplished and adventurous groups in new music," is dedicated to reshaping the way music is created and experienced. With a modular makeup of 35 leading instrumentalists, performing in forces ranging from solos to large ensembles, ICE functions as performer, presenter, and educator, advancing the music of our time by developing innovative new works and new strategies for audience engagement. ICE redefines concert music as it brings together new work and new listeners in the 21st century. Since its founding in 2001, ICE has premiered over 500 compositions––the majority of these new works by emerging composers––in venues spanning from alternative spaces to concert halls around the world. The ensemble has received the American Music Center's Trailblazer Award for its contributions to the field, the ASCAP/Chamber Music America Award for Adventurous Programming, and was most recently named Musical America Worldwide's Ensemble of the Year in 2013.
